Luke Grant labels Labor Party ‘hopeless’ amid 24/7 aged care announcement
Luke Grant has slammed the Labor Party and Mark Dreyfus for causing confusion amid the announcement of planned 24/7 aged care.
Shadow Attorney-General Mark Dreyfus told the ABC on Monday evening, that the 24/7 nursing requirement could be ‘paused’ if a Labor government failed to grow the workforce in time.
Luke said, “We’ve got an Opposition making grand pledges to deliver those exact same recommendations, ahead of schedule, without any proper costing, and without a definitive answer as to whether Australia has enough nurses to back it up”.
“They don’t even know what they’re running on.”
